Ironman Mallorca Swim Course

The swim takes place in the Bay of Alcudia and starts and ends at the Playa de Muro in Port d’Alcudia. The bay is beautifully protected from any rough seas which is a welcomed relief for the athletes as they navigate the 1.9km/1.2-mile swim course.

Ironman Mallorca Bike Course

Next up is the 90km/56-mile bike ride that takes athletes from the Bay of Alcudia to the Serra de Tramuntana mountains and passes through the Coll de Femenia. The bike course has 800m of positive elevation gain so be prepared for some climbing as you reach the highest point at 576m at Coll de la Batalla.

Ironman Mallorca Run Course

Finally, the Ironman 70.3 Mallorca concludes with a 21.1km /13.1 mile run which is comprised of three loops of the run course adjacent to Alcudia Bay. The finish line is a mere stone’s throw from the sea and finishes almost next to the swim course start line.

Things to Consider When Choosing Your Hotel for an Ironman Competition

Now, it’s important to bear a few things in mind before booking and committing to your accommodation in Mallorca. The last thing you want is to get caught out with harsh cancellation policies or be kilometers away from the start and finish lines.

Let’s take a look at some of the most important considerations when it comes to hotels and the best area to stay in Alcudia. 

  • Location! First and foremost, location is crucial! You want to be conveniently located to ensure that you can access the event start and finish lines effortlessly. No one wants to worry about long commutes when you have an Ironman event to conquer!
  • Cancellation policies. Don’t get caught out with cancellation policies that come back to haunt you. Read the small print and familiarize yourself with the policies of the hotel – trust me.
  • Budget. Now, this is probably one of the most important considerations for all athletes. Not everyone is born with a silver spoon and has an unlimited budget. You can effortlessly filter your search on booking sites like booking.com to fit your budget.
  • Is it bike-friendly? Remember, you’ll be travelling with your carbon steed and will need to ensure that the hotel is happy for you to store your bike either in the room or in a parking garage.
  • Reviews. Always read the reviews of guests who have stayed at the hotel before. This will give you a good idea of how good or bad the hotel is.
  • What amenities are on offer? Is there a sauna/steam room, fitness center, or swimming pool? These are welcomed as an athlete prior to and post the event. 
  • Is there a restaurant at the hotel? Is breakfast included or extra? 
  • What sights and tourist attractions are close by for exploring on your off-days?

How to travel to Alcudia, Mallorca

Palma de Mallorca Airport (PMI) is the main gateway to Mallorca. It is one of the busiest airports in Spain with connections to the main cities of Europe.

Located in Palma de Mallorca it is an approximately 45-minute drive to cover the 61km from the airport to Alcudia. There are buses available although it will be a hassle to board with bikes.  We like to compare flights on Skyscanner and Google Flights.
